Решавање проблема Сафари - спори оптерећења страница

Онемогућавање ДНС Префетцхинг може побољшати перформансе Сафари

Сафари, заједно са скоро свим осталим претраживачима, сада укључује ДНС префетцхинг, функцију дизајнирану да сурфује вебу убрзано искуство гледајући све линкове уграђене у веб страницу и упитаће свој ДНС сервер како би ријешио сваку везу до своје стварне ИП адреса.

Када ДНС префетхинг ради добро, до тренутка када кликнете на везу на веб локацији, ваш претраживач већ зна ИП адресу и спреман је да учита тражену страницу. Ово значи врло брзо вријеме одговора док се крећете са странице на страницу.

Па, како то може бити лоша ствар? Па, испоставља се да ДНС префетцхинг може имати неке занимљиве недостатке, иако само под одређеним условима. Док већина претраживача сада има ДНС префетцхинг, концентришемо се на Сафари , јер је то водећи претраживач за Мац.

Када Сафари учитава веб страницу, понекад се страница приказује и изгледа вам спремна да проучите његов садржај. Али када покушате да се померате нагоре или надоле према доле или померите показивач миша, добијате курсор. Можда ћете приметити да се икона освежавања прегледача још увек врти. Све ово указује на то да док је страница успешно израђена, нешто спречава претраживач да одговара на ваше потребе.

Постоји више могућих криваца. Страница би могла имати грешке, сервер на лицу мјеста може бити спор, или се дио странице на страни, као што је огласна услуга треће стране, може смањити. Ове врсте проблема су обично привремене и вероватно ће нестати за кратко време, од неколико минута до неколико дана.

ДНС префетцхинг питања раде мало другачије. Обоје обично утјечу на исту веб локацију сваки пут када га посјетите по први пут у сесију претраживача Сафари. Можете посетити сајт рано ујутру и открити да је врло споро реагирати. Вратите се сат времена касније, и све је добро. Следећег дана, исти образац се понавља. Ваша прва посета је спора, стварно спора; било какве накнадне посјете тог дана су у реду.

Дакле, шта се догађа са ДНС Префетцхинг?

У нашем примеру горе, када одете на веб локацију прво ујутро, Сафари искористи прилику да пошаље ДНС упит за сваку везу коју види на страници. У зависности од странице коју учитујете, то може бити неколико упита или би могло бити хиљаде, поготово ако је веб локација која има пуно коментара корисника или посетите форум неког типа.

Проблем није толико толико да Сафари шаље тоне ДНС упита, али неки старији кућни мрежни рутери не могу да обрадјују оптерећење захтева, или да је ДНС систем вашег ИСП-а подмерен за захтеве или комбинацију оба.

Постоје два једноставна начина за решавање проблема и решавање проблема преузимања ДНС-а са перформансама. Водимо вас кроз оба метода.

Промените ДНС сервис провајдера

Први метод је промена провајдера ДНС сервиса. Многи људи користе било какве ДНС поставке које им ИСП-у наводи да користе, али уопште можете користити било који ДНС провајдер који желите. По мом искуству, наш локални ИСП-ов ДНС сервис је прилично лош. Промена пружалаца услуга била је добар потез са наше стране; то може бити добар потез за вас.

Можете да тестирате свог тренутног ДНС провајдера помоћу упутстава у следећем водичу:

Мој претраживач не приказује правилну веб локацију: како да поправим овај проблем?

Ако након провере ваше ДНС услуге одлучите да промените на другу, очигледно је питање које је то? Можете покушати ОпенДНС или Гоогле Публиц ДНС, два популарна и бесплатна ДНС провајдера сервиса, али ако вам не смета да направите мало подешавања, можете користити сљедеће водиче за тестирање различитих ДНС провајдера услуга да бисте видели који је најбољи за вас:

Тестирајте свој ДНС провајдер да бисте стекли бржи веб приступ

Када одаберете ДНС провајдера за коришћење, можете пронаћи упутства о промени ДНС поставки Мац-а у следећем водичу:

Управљајте ДНС вашег Мац-а

Када се промените у други ДНС провајдер, напустите Сафари. Покрените Сафари, а затим пробајте веб локацију која је изазвала поновљене проблеме.

Ако се сајт сада учитава ОК и Сафари остаје одговоран, онда сте сви постављени; проблем је био са ДНС провајдером. Да бисте двоструко сигурни, покушајте поново да учитате исти веб сајт након што затворите и поново покренете Мац. Ако све и даље ради, завршио си.

Ако није, проблем је вероватно на другим местима. Можете се вратити на раније ДНС подешавања или само оставити нове, посебно ако сте се променили у један од ДНС провајдера који сам предложио горе; Оба добро раде.

Онемогућите ДНС префиктирање Сафари

Ако и даље имате проблема, можете их решити тако што никада више не посетите ту веб страницу, или онемогућавају префетирање ДНС-а.

Било би лепо ако је префетцховање ДНС-а било приоритетно подешавање у Сафари-у. Било би још лепше ако бисте могли онемогућити префетцховање на основу сајта. Али пошто ниједна од ових опција тренутно није доступна, морамо користити другачији приступ да онемогућимо функцију.

  1. Лаунцх Терминал, налази се у / Апплицатионс / Утилитиес.
  2. У прозору Терминал који се отвори, унесите или копирајте / залијепите следећу команду:
  3. подразумевано пише цом.аппле.сафари ВебКитДНСПрефетцхингЕнаблед -боолеан фалсе
  4. Притисните ентер или вратите се.
  5. Затим можете напустити Терминал.

Престаните и поново покрените Сафари, а затим поново посетите веб локацију која је изазвала проблеме. Сада би требало да ради добро. Проблем је вјероватно био старији рутер у вашој кући. Ако једном замените рутер или ако произвођач рутера нуди надоградњу фирмвера који решава проблем, ви ћете желети да поново укључите ДНС префетцхинг. Ево како.

  1. Лаунцх Терминал.
  2. У прозору Терминал унесите следећу команду:
  3. подразумевано пише цом.аппле.сафари ВебКитДНСПрефетцхингЕнаблед
  4. Притисните ентер или вратите се.
  5. Затим можете напустити Терминал.

То је то; требало би да сте сви постављени. На дуже стазе, обично вам је боље да омогућите ДНС префетцхинг. Међутим, ако често посећујете веб локацију која има проблеме, окретање ДНС префетцхинг-а може свакодневно посјетити угоднијом.